The question is a physics problem where we are asked to find the change in elevation of a dolphin after jumping and diving. The dolphin jumps 24.5 meters above sea level and then dives 14.8 meters below sea level. To find the change in these levels, we simply calculate the difference between the two positions.
The change in elevation is the dolphin's highest point above sea level minus its lowest point below sea level, which is 24.5 meters - (-14.8 meters) = 24.5 meters + 14.8 meters = 39.3 meters. Thus, the change in the dolphin's elevation from the highest point jumped above sea level to the lowest point dived below sea level is 39.3 meters.
